How do you find the slope of a dt graph?

Pick two points on the line and determine their coordinates. Determine the difference in y-coordinates of these two points (rise). Determine the difference in x-coordinates for these two points (run). Divide the difference in y-coordinates by the difference in x-coordinates (rise/run or slope).

What is the slope of speed-time graph?

A sloping line on a speed-time graph represents an acceleration . The sloping line shows that the speed of the object is changing. The object is either speeding up or slowing down. The steeper the slope of the line the greater the acceleration.

Is the slope of a dt graph velocity?

The principle is that the slope of the line on a position-time graph is equal to the velocity of the object. If the object is moving with a velocity of +4 m/s, then the slope of the line will be +4 m/s.

What does a DT graph show?

A distance-time graph shows how the distance and speed of an object changes with time. This graph shows the movement of three objects over time. The slope, or steepness, of each line indicates the object’s rate of speed.

What does slope of vt graph give?

The slope of the velocity time graph indicates the acceleration produced when we plot velocity along the Y-axis and time along the X-axis.

How would you describe slope?

The slope is defined as the ratio of the vertical change between two points, the rise, to the horizontal change between the same two points, the run.

What does a curved line on a d-t graph mean?

curved line on a d-t graph means acceleration is happening. During this time period, the line curves upwards. The line becomes steeper and steeper as it continues. This means that the slope of the line is getting bigger and bigger. Since slope is related to velocity, your velocity must be increasing. You are accelerating!
